The SN74LVC1G34YZPR is a high-quality, single gate logic device from Texas Instruments, a globally renowned manufacturer of semiconductors. This product is a part of Texas Instruments' wider LVC family, which is known for its low-voltage capabilities.
This device is a single buffer gate designed for 1.65-V to 5.5-V VCC operation. It is optimized for low-voltage applications, making it a versatile choice for a diverse range of electrical and electronic systems. The inputs can be driven from either 3.3-V or 5-V devices, which makes it suitable for mixed-voltage system environments.
Key Features
- Wide Operating Voltage: The SN74LVC1G34YZPR operates comfortably at a wide voltage range of 1.65 V to 5.5 V.
- High Drive Strength: This device can drive up to 32 mA at 4.5 V. It also provides balanced propagation delays and transition times.
- Maximum Tolerant Inputs: The device has maximum tolerant inputs that are suitable for up to 5.5 V. This enables direct interfacing with the bus lines of 2.7-V to 3.3-V systems.
- ESD Protection: It has excellent electrostatic discharge (ESD) protection exceeding JESD 22, 2000-V Human-Body Model (A114-A), 200-V Machine Model (A115-A) and 1000-V Charged-Device Model (C101).
